By the way, if flashrom works for a particular board on 32bit Linux, it
should work on 64bit as well and vice versa.

However, I believe the flash chip you mentioned for a few boards (PMC
49LF004T) does not exist according to PMC. Did you mean the PMC
Pm49FL004T?
I know what the official Tyan website says (PMC 49LF004T), but I believe
that to be an error.
It would be great if you could look up the actual engraved model number
(below the colorful sticker) on such a flash chip.
